How can cultivating a mindfulness practice not only improve decision-making skills in high-pressure situations, but also enhance overall emotional intelligence and resilience?
Cultivating a mindfulness practice can improve decision-making skills in high-pressure situations by helping individuals stay present, focused, and aware of their thoughts and emotions. This heightened awareness can lead to more rational and strategic decision-making. Additionally, mindfulness practice can enhance overall emotional intelligence by increasing self-awareness, empathy, and the ability to regulate emotions effectively. This, in turn, can improve communication, relationships, and conflict resolution skills. Furthermore, mindfulness practice can build resilience by helping individuals develop a greater sense of inner strength, adaptability, and the ability to bounce back from setbacks or challenges.
